Bernburg offers a quiet, manageable alternative to Germany’s bustling metropolises, making it ideal for professionals seeking a slower pace and a lower cost of living. With a modest expat community, you’ll find a stable environment where safety and reliable healthcare are standard, though you won't find the high-energy international social scene of Berlin or Munich.
Daily life is defined by ease of movement via solid public transport and a sense of local community. However, the trade-off is a certain level of provincialism; while the lifestyle is peaceful and predictable, the limited scale of the city means professional networking and cultural variety are more concentrated and less diverse than in larger urban hubs.
Bernburg, Germany has a **humid continental** climate with warm summers, cold winters, and precipitation spread through the year. Long-term climate references for Bernburg show an annual average temperature around 10°C, about 644 mm of precipitation, and roughly 2,543 sunshine hours per year, which fits a temperate inland climate rather than a Mediterranean one. Spring
March - May
5-15°C
Spring is cool to mild, with temperatures rising steadily through the season. Rain is common, and the weather can change quickly between sunny periods and showers.
Moderate rainfall
Summer
June - August
18-25°C
Summer is generally warm, with July typically the warmest month and average temperatures near 20°C. Rainfall is moderate and often arrives in short showers or thunderstorms.
Moderate rainfall
Autumn
September - November
6-15°C
Autumn is cool and increasingly damp, with temperatures dropping steadily through the season. Cloudier days become more frequent, and the first frosts can arrive by late autumn.
Moderate rainfall
Winter
December - February
-1-4°C
Winter is cold, often gray, and occasionally snowy, with January usually the coldest month. Humidity tends to feel high in winter, which can make conditions feel colder than the thermometer suggests.
Low rainfall
